The Most Important Data about INTERIM HEALTHCARE OF CHICAGO
We've looked at a lot of home health care agencies; this is what we think you need to see first. Read through this even if you do not have much time. (It's the tl;dr section.)
The overall 5-star Rating for INTERIM HEALTHCARE OF CHICAGO is 2.5 out of possible 5 stars (with 1 being the lowest and 5 the highest rating). The average rating nationally for a home health care agency is 3. The agency is highly recommended by 70% of its customers. This is LOWER than the national average. The percentage of patients who gave INTERIM HEALTHCARE OF CHICAGO a rating of 9 or 10 was 81%. This is LOWER than the national average. The agency has been participating in Medicare since 01/01/1980. The agency costs LESS than the average agency nationally. The agency serves 223 ZIP codes.

DTC Performance for INTERIM HEALTHCARE OF CHICAGO
The DTC-PAC measures assess successful discharge to the community from a PAC setting, with successful discharge to the community including no unplanned rehospitalizations and no death in the 31 days following discharge. Specifically, these measures report a provider’s riskstandardized rate of Medicare fee-for-service (FFS) patients/residents who are discharged to the community following a PAC stay, and do not have an unplanned readmission to an acute care hospital or LTCH in the 31 days following discharge to community, and who remain alive during the 31 days following discharge to community. Community, for this measure, is defined as home or self care, with or without home health services, based on Patient Discharge Status Codes 01, 06, 81, and 86 on the Medicare FFS claim. A statistical approach is used to calculate confidence intervals for the provider’s DTC rate. These confidence intervals are then compared to the national observed DTC rate to assign providers to performance categories for public reporting. The performance categories are (i) better than the national rate, (ii) no different from the national rate, and (iii) worse than the national rate.
DTC performance is Better Than National Rate for INTERIM HEALTHCARE OF CHICAGO.

Performance Measures for INTERIM HEALTHCARE OF CHICAGO
All of the measures included in HHC are proportions that show what percentage of patients or episodes experienced the process or outcome being measured. For all measures, except acute care hospitalization, a higher measure value means a better score.
Process of care measures tell you how often an agency gave the recommended care (like checking patients for depression when they start getting care). A score of 88% for a process of care measure is interpreted as 88% of the patients received the recommended care during their episode of care.
